Usual thank you to Gareth at Coldingham for hosting our site day and for the tea/coffee and sandwiches at lunchtime.  Also for Appertiser for organizing the day.

Went in boat with Tinnie Pete, we had to go in one of the smaller blue boats, (note if you are going in the boats try to get one of the white ones much bigger), set off into the mist and we hit a couple of fish straight away, here we go, its going to be a good day.  The mist gradually lifted and there was fish showing all over the lake.  These fish were on something small and not easily fooled into taking.  We were fishing shipmans buzzers and by lunchtime Peter had 7 and I had 5, we both had dropped/missed a few.  After lunch there was less showing but Peter still managed another 4 to the boat, but all I could do was loose fish on the anchor rope and get smashed off and drop fish.  The day ended to quickly, we started to wrap up and we noticed Pete's rod had broken, possibly when trying to net a fish his seat must have nipped his spare rod, again possibly due the tight confines of the boat.

Total for the day for us 16 to the boat Peter 11, me 5.    Black and hares ear shipmans.     Possibly could have caught more pulling but it was a challenge to catch those fish that were rising.

Really looking forward to the site day as I'd never fished Coldingham before, picked up Brad ( sleepyhead ) then to Brians' , and off up a sunny A1, until we got to roundabout near Mc D's and suddenly you could hardly see a thing for the fog, which lasted until lunchtime  Shocked  When we arrived everyone was nearly ready so a few quick hellos and on to the water. I was sharing a boat with Brad as his partner couldn't make it, I wish we had hired a motor as the oars were useless, anyway off we went, Brad had seen fish moving in the wind lanes so we anchored, or tried to, as the anchors were hopeless as well, and was soon into some fish on a blue flash damsel, I was pulling a yellow blob on a slow sinker as it had been working well the day before, but not today, for me anyway ! As I sat recovering from all the rowing, Brad kept the fish coming, landing a lovely blue about 5lb, a beautiful brown and some good rainbows, all the fish were first class fighters, not that I had any personal experience of that up to now  Mad Looking at the pile of flies I had tried with no success, I put a killer on and at last had a tremendous tug, nearly pulling me out the boat  Shocked but that was all it was, a tug, no hook up , and so we, sorry I, rowed back for some lunch with a blank ! After a bit craic and 2 bacon butties off we went again, a bit easier this time as Brad was rowing Laughing I was fishing a floating line this time with a Bushy on the point, and we headed to the far end of the lough, casting towards the reeds/ lily pads I finally hooked into a lovely blue about 4 lbs which put up a great fight Blank off ! The sun was out now and Coldingham really is a lovely place when we saw what we'd missed in the morning fog. We did this drift a couple of times towards the reeds as a few fish were showing and I managed another nice rainbow on a foam beetle, and although the weather had improved slightly there was still a cool easterly wind, and the fishing wasn't easy with Brad only picking up 1 more, before all the rowing took it's toll on his back and I was back in the rowing seat Rolling Eyes  Well that was it for me, missed a few off the top, but no more fish, at least it wasn't a blank , which I thought was on the cards at lunch.
